Output 6bda5407af39e3e17768f6c965a87f17b42c6829f6db6fd110573b0a498e29b1:0

value
10561425
script pubkey
OP_0 OP_PUSHBYTES_20 f4962bb38781060deda9e715bce3a29baa60521a
address
bc1q7jtzhvu8syrqmmdfuu2mecaznw4xq5s6tfzhk4
transaction
6bda5407af39e3e17768f6c965a87f17b42c6829f6db6fd110573b0a498e29b1
confirmations
73618
spent
true